What's The Definition Of Prohibitory?
[adj] tending to discourage (especially of prices); "the price was prohibitive"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Prohibitory: preventative | preventive | prohibitive Related Terms | Find terms related to Prohibitory: See Also | Prohibitory In Webster's Dictionary \Pro*hib"it*o*ry\, a. [L. prohibitorius.]
Tending to prohibit, forbid, or exclude; implying
prohibition; forbidding; as, a prohibitory law; a prohibitory
price.
{Prohibitory index}. (R. C. Ch.) See under {Index}.
